It's All About That Plate Tectonics, Baby

Let's get scientific for a sec (don't worry, I'll keep it breezy). LA sits on the Pacific Plate, which is, shall we say, having a bit of a tiff with the North American Plate. These two tectonic titans are constantly rubbing shoulders (or plates, in this case), and when they get a little too touchy-feely, we get earthquakes. It's like a cosmic wrestling match, and we're the unfortunate ringside spectators.

How to Stay Calm During an Earthquake

  • How to stay calm during an earthquake: Focus on deep breaths and remember, it's just the Earth having a moment.
  • How to prepare for an earthquake: Create an emergency kit with essentials like water, food, and a flashlight.
  • How to secure your home: Anchor heavy furniture to the walls to prevent toppling.
  • How to create an earthquake evacuation plan: Determine safe meeting points for your family.
  • How to deal with earthquake anxiety: Practice relaxation techniques and seek support if needed.
